Biological Background: LAMP1/CD107a Function and Localization

  • Lysosome-associated membrane glycoprotein 1 (LAMP1), also known as CD107a, LGP-120, or P2B, is a heavily glycosylated type I transmembrane protein and a major component of the lysosomal membrane.
  • It is critical for lysosome biogenesis, autophagy, and cholesterol homeostasis (PubMed:15121881). Related references: PMID:15121881
  • LAMP1 directly inhibits the proton channel TMEM175 to regulate lysosomal pH, ensuring proper hydrolase activity.
  • In natural killer (NK) cells, LAMP1 facilitates cytotoxic granule movement and perforin trafficking, and it protects the cell from autolysis by its own granule contents (PubMed:23847195). Related references: PMID:23847195
  • LAMP1 is implicated in tumor cell metastasis (PubMed:2676155). Related references: PMID:2676155
  • It localizes to lysosomal, late endosomal, and cell surface membranes, as well as cytolytic granule membranes in immune cells.
  • The protein contains N-linked glycosylation sites, disulfide bonds, and a short cytoplasmic tail, characteristic of the LAMP family.

Experimental Guidance and Technical Tips

  • The immunogen covers amino acids 208–363 of mouse LAMP1, a segment located in the intraluminal domain; consider its accessibility for flow cytometry depending on membrane integrity and permeabilization.
  • For detection of surface LAMP1 on live cells (e.g., NK cells), test both permeabilized and non-permeabilized protocols to optimize signal, as the epitope may be less exposed.
  • Validate antibody specificity using appropriate knockout or knockdown controls in mouse cell lines.
  • Given the reported molecular weight of ~43 kDa, expect a higher apparent mass due to extensive glycosylation; confirm by western blot if multiplexing.
